[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
91/104: gnu: alpine: Update to 2.22.
From: |
guix-commits |
Subject: |
91/104: gnu: alpine: Update to 2.22. |
Date: |
Sun, 17 May 2020 11:36:51 -0400 (EDT) |
nckx pushed a commit to branch core-updates
in repository guix.
commit 338a6af688cf4824ce5ae35e2974108e7d5f0126
Author: Tobias Geerinckx-Rice <address@hidden>
AuthorDate: Sun May 17 02:27:27 2020 +0200
gnu: alpine: Update to 2.22.
* gnu/packages/mail.scm (alpine): Update to 2.22.
[arguments]: Add ‘assume-shadow-passwords’ phase.
---
gnu/packages/mail.scm | 13 ++++++++++---
1 file changed, 10 insertions(+), 3 deletions(-)
diff --git a/gnu/packages/mail.scm b/gnu/packages/mail.scm
index ca1828b..6e39dc2 100644
--- a/gnu/packages/mail.scm
+++ b/gnu/packages/mail.scm
@@ -2681,7 +2681,7 @@ operators and scripters.")
;; Upstream doesn't use git tags, but does ‘tag’ their releases in the
;; commit message. Hence the lack of GIT-VERSIONing despite using a commit
;; ID below. Don't forget to update it…
- (version "2.21.99999")
+ (version "2.22")
(source
(origin
(method git-fetch)
@@ -2691,10 +2691,10 @@ operators and scripters.")
;; http://alpine.freeiz.com/alpine/readme/README.patches
(uri (git-reference
(url "http://repo.or.cz/alpine.git")
- (commit "abeb2c25935ef8c75f1e5deef0f81276754dc975")))
+ (commit "b50297779a4becb9ceca9c6b5b375d526fe3df78")))
(file-name (git-file-name name version))
(sha256
- (base32 "0rqgbw08a5lj41dkp82aq480lqkc4bnxagna7wpqffi821n8gkwz"))
+ (base32 "06js44fvdl7l33hfd4lsxpcd1cz3c0h796cswyzz0lkrzx89yl48"))
(modules '((guix build utils)))
(snippet
'(begin
@@ -2720,6 +2720,13 @@ operators and scripters.")
"--with-date-stamp=Thu 1 Jan 01:00:01 CET
1970")
#:phases
(modify-phases %standard-phases
+ (add-after 'unpack 'assume-shadow-passwords
+ ;; Alpine's configure script confuses ‘shadow password support’ with
+ ;; ‘/etc/shadow exists in the build environment’. It does not.
+ (lambda _
+ (substitute* "configure"
+ (("test -f /etc/shadow") "true"))
+ #t))
(add-after 'unpack 'make-reproducible
(lambda _
;; This removes time-dependent code to make alpine reproducible.
- 88/104: gnu: julius: Remove unused bundled libraries., (continued)
- 88/104: gnu: julius: Remove unused bundled libraries., guix-commits, 2020/05/17
- 79/104: gnu: guile-hall: Update to 0.3.1., guix-commits, 2020/05/17
- 82/104: gnu: samplv1: Update to 0.9.14., guix-commits, 2020/05/17
- 92/104: gnu: alpine: Support cross-gcc'ing., guix-commits, 2020/05/17
- 93/104: gnu: soundconverter: Update to 3.0.2., guix-commits, 2020/05/17
- 84/104: gnu: supertux: Update to 0.6.2., guix-commits, 2020/05/17
- 86/104: gnu: mumble: End phase with #t., guix-commits, 2020/05/17
- 89/104: gnu: java-xz: Remove duplicate definition., guix-commits, 2020/05/17
- 90/104: gnu: spiped: Update to 1.6.1., guix-commits, 2020/05/17
- 85/104: gnu: java-jmapviewer: Return #t from all phases., guix-commits, 2020/05/17
- 91/104: gnu: alpine: Update to 2.22.,
guix-commits <=
- 101/104: gnu: cups: Update to 2.3.3 [fixes CVE-2020-3898 & CVE-2019-8842]., guix-commits, 2020/05/17
- 103/104: gnu: cups, cups-minimal: Ungraft 2.3.3., guix-commits, 2020/05/17
- 104/104: gnu: cups-filters: Update to 1.27.4., guix-commits, 2020/05/17
- 87/104: gnu: julius: Update to 1.4.0., guix-commits, 2020/05/17
- 96/104: gnu: racket: Update to 7.7., guix-commits, 2020/05/17
- 102/104: etc: Install mount unit only if it exists., guix-commits, 2020/05/17
- 80/104: gnu: synthv1: Update to 0.9.14., guix-commits, 2020/05/17
- 94/104: doc: meson-build-system: Fix build type documentation., guix-commits, 2020/05/17
- 95/104: gnu: qemu-minimal: Use 'match' to find architecture., guix-commits, 2020/05/17
- 97/104: gnu: kdeconnect: Fix kdeconnectd path., guix-commits, 2020/05/17